Elon Musk recently issued a strong dismissal of reports suggesting that SpaceX was developing a handheld artificial intelligence device, labeling the claims as “Utterly False” on social media.

    This statement followed media reports indicating that SpaceX had showcased an early prototype featuring xAI‘s advanced artificial intelligence technologies and a proprietary operating system to a select group of investors ahead of its initial public offering. The details emerging from these reports painted a picture of a device that was remarkably sleek, reportedly thinner than the iPhone, built on a Qualcomm Snapdragon system-on-chip.

    While the integration of cutting-edge AI was clearly the centerpiece of the prototype, the exact nature of how xAI‘s systems were woven into the proprietary operating system remained intentionally vague. Analysts suggest that while the concept is undeniably ambitious, the device currently exists in its infancy. This means that the final specifications and appearance will likely diverge significantly from the prototype shown to investors.

    The development story adds another layer of complexity. Earlier reports hinted at long-term plans for a specialized handset. At the time, Musk suggested a hypothetical Starlink phone was “not out of the question at some point,” though he clarified it would be an AI-centric device significantly different from current smartphones. This shift in tone—denying the development of a full smartphone—highlights the ongoing tension between grand ambition and tangible product realities.

    The path to creating an always-connected, handheld device with advanced AI capabilities mirrors Musk’s long-standing pursuit of an “everything app.” Theoretically, building such a device is not impossible; modern telecommunications standards like 3GPP Release-18 and Release-19 specifications provide the framework for connecting 5G and satellite networks. However, realizing this vision requires overcoming significant engineering challenges, particularly in balancing performance, reliability, power consumption, and the necessary backbone bandwidth required to support global communications.
